How to Choose the Right Marketing Agency for Your Business

Two people discussing how to choose the right digital marketing agency for their business

Have you ever felt confused while searching for a digital marketing agency in Lahore? Honestly, I’ve been there too. When I first stepped into the world of online marketing, I didn’t know who to trust, what services I really needed, or how to tell the difference between a good agency and a bad one.

That’s why I’ve written this article — not just for the sake of content, but to help you make a smart decision based on real experience and research. If you’re a business owner in Pakistan looking to grow online, then you already know the internet is full of noise. But don’t worry — by the end of this article, you’ll understand exactly how to choose the best digital marketing agency in Lahore that matches your goals, budget, and vision.

Let’s dive into it.

What Does a Digital Marketing Agency Actually Do?

Before we talk about choosing an agency, let me first explain what a digital marketing agency really does. You might already know some of it, but it’s important to clear things up.

A digital marketing agency helps your business grow online using different digital tools and platforms. Their services usually include:

  • Search Engine Optimization (SEO) – So your website ranks on Google

  • Social Media Marketing – To promote your business on platforms like Facebook, Instagram, LinkedIn

  • Pay-Per-Click (PPC) Advertising – Running paid ads on Google and social media

  • Content Marketing – Creating useful blogs, videos, graphics to engage your audience

  • Email Marketing – Sending emails to your customers or leads

  • Web Design & Development – Building a mobile-friendly, fast-loading, beautiful website

Now, that sounds like a lot. But don’t worry — you don’t need all of these services at once. I’ll explain how to figure out what’s right for you.

Why It’s Hard to Pick the Right Marketing Agency in Lahore

There are hundreds of agencies in Lahore claiming to offer the best digital marketing services. Many look professional on the outside, but trust me — looks can be deceiving.

When I was looking for a marketing agency in Lahore, I came across many websites that looked fancy but delivered very poor results. Some would just copy-paste strategies from YouTube, and others didn’t even know how Google Ads really worked.

So, why is it hard to pick the right one?

  • Too many options, but little proof of real success

  • Lack of transparency in pricing and strategy

  • Unrealistic promises like “Rank #1 on Google in 7 days”

  • Agencies that outsource everything without in-house experts

That’s why it’s important to dig deeper.

What to Look for in a Digital Marketing Agency in Lahore

When choosing an agency, I recommend focusing on 7 key factors:

1. Proven Experience and Case Studies

Always ask this simple question: “Can you show me real results?”

A good digital marketing agency in Lahore will proudly share:

  • Case studies

  • Past client results

  • Testimonials

  • Screenshots from Google Analytics or ad reports

If they avoid sharing proof, take that as a red flag.

2. Services That Match Your Business Goals

Are you a local clothing brand in Lahore? Then your focus might be social media marketing and Instagram ads. Are you a service provider? Then maybe SEO services in Lahore will suit you better.

Don’t just go for a full package blindly. Talk to the agency and see if their services align with what you actually need.

3. Transparency in Pricing and Strategy

Avoid agencies that don’t clearly tell you what they’ll do, how they’ll do it, and how much it will cost. You have the right to know what you’re paying for.

Ask things like:

  • “What platforms will you advertise on?”

  • “How much of the budget goes to ads, and how much is your fee?”

  • “What’s the monthly report format?”

4. In-House Experts, Not Just Freelancers

Some so-called agencies just act as middlemen. They take your money and outsource the work to freelancers who don’t even know your business.

Instead, find a Lahore digital marketing company that has:

  • An in-house SEO expert

  • A content writer

  • A graphic designer

  • A paid ads specialist

This way, everyone is on the same page.

5. Ongoing Communication and Monthly Reporting

Once you hire an agency, you want to stay updated. Good agencies offer:

  • Weekly or bi-weekly updates

  • Clear reports with KPIs (Key Performance Indicators)

  • Honest feedback about what’s working and what’s not

You shouldn’t have to chase them for updates.

Best Digital Marketing Services in Lahore – What to Expect

Best digital marketing service in Lahore for growing online business
Explore top-rated digital marketing services

Here are the most common and effective services offered by top marketing agencies in Lahore:

SEO Services in Lahore

This helps your website show up when people search on Google. For example, if you sell clothes in Lahore, you want to appear when someone types “affordable clothing store in Lahore”.

Social Media Marketing Lahore

With millions of Pakistanis using Facebook, Instagram, and TikTok every day, social media marketing is powerful. Good agencies help you:

  • Grow your followers

  • Post content regularly

  • Run paid ads to get more leads and sales

PPC Services in Lahore (Google & Facebook Ads)

Pay-Per-Click ads are the fastest way to get traffic. But only if managed correctly.

A performance marketing agency in Pakistan can help you:

  • Run Google Ads with smart bidding

  • Create eye-catching ad creatives

  • Set up conversion tracking

  • Optimize landing pages

Email Marketing Services in Pakistan

Many businesses ignore this, but email marketing still works — especially for:

  • Retargeting customers

  • Promoting discounts

  • Sending newsletters

Website Design & Development

A good marketing agency in Pakistan will also offer mobile-friendly, fast websites. This is important for both SEO and customer experience.

Red Flags – When to Walk Away

From my own experience, here are a few warning signs:

  • They promise #1 rankings overnight

  • They can’t explain their strategy in simple words

  • They don’t track or report anything

  • They don’t ask about your business goals

  • Their website has poor design or outdated blogs

Final Thoughts – My Honest Advice to You

If you’ve read this far, you already care more than most. And that’s a great thing. Choosing the right digital marketing agency in Lahore is not about going with the most expensive or the one with the fanciest logo. It’s about trust, transparency, and strategy that fits your goals.

Start with a conversation. Ask the right questions. And always look for real proof.

As someone who’s been through the trial and error, I can tell you this: The right agency will feel like a partner — not a vendor.

FAQs – Digital Marketing Agencies in Lahore

What is the average cost of hiring a digital marketing agency in Lahore?

It depends on the services. Basic social media marketing starts from PKR 25,000/month, while full-service packages can go beyond PKR 100,000/month.

How long does SEO take to show results?

SEO is a long-term game. On average, it takes 3 to 6 months to see noticeable results, depending on your competition and keywords.

Can I hire a digital marketing agency for just one service?

Yes, absolutely. You can hire them for SEO, social media, PPC, or even just content writing. Many agencies offer flexible plans.

What are the signs of a bad digital marketing agency?

No transparency, fake promises, poor communication, and no proof of results. Avoid any agency that doesn’t give you regular updates or hide their strategies.

Are there affordable digital marketing agencies in Lahore?

Yes, many small but talented teams offer affordable and high-quality digital marketing services. Look for agencies that focus on results, not just fancy branding.

About the Author

Zeeshan Ameer

I’m Zeeshan Ameer, a digital marketing expert with a strong focus on SEO, strategy, and business growth.

As an SEO specialist, entrepreneur, and digital marketing strategist, I’ve helped multiple international businesses boost their online visibility and drive significant revenue growth. With a deep passion for results and a proven track record, I’m dedicated to delivering strategies that make a measurable impact.

You may also like these